The core performance of any elliptical trainer is defined by three non-negotiable metrics: stride length, flywheel mass, and frame geometry.

When evaluating the E-600 elliptical specs, it is essential to isolate these variables from aesthetic features. A common misconception is that a larger console or more resistance levels equate to a better machine. In reality, the user experience is dictated by the biomechanics of the motion.

The E-600 features a 510mm stride length. This dimension is critical because it aligns with the natural gait cycle of the majority of adult users. A stride that is too short forces the user into a cramped, unnatural motion, increasing stress on the knees and hips. Conversely, a stride that is excessively long can cause overextension. The 510mm measurement sits within the optimal range for commercial applications, accommodating users of varying heights without requiring complex adjustments. Why Does the Front-Drive Structure Matter for Commercial Use?

The position of the flywheel dictates the machine’s footprint, maintenance accessibility, and user perception of stability.

In commercial environments, space is a premium commodity. Hotel gyms, in particular, often operate in converted spaces where every square meter counts. The front-drive structure of the E-600 offers a distinct advantage here. By placing the flywheel and drive mechanism at the front, the machine achieves a more balanced center of gravity without extending the rear base unnecessarily. This results in a smaller footprint compared to many rear-drive counterparts, allowing facility managers to fit more units into a given area.

From a maintenance perspective, the front-drive design simplifies access to critical components. Technicians can reach the belt, bearings, and resistance unit from the front without having to tilt or disassemble the entire rear section. This reduces downtime, which is crucial for hotels and gyms that cannot afford to have equipment out of service for extended periods.
